Across
1
Sexy woman to improvise (4) : VAMP
3
Eccentric cooked hot waffle with piece of lemon (3,3,4) : OFFTHEWALL
9
Inspect poetry written in Old English (7) : OVERSEE
11
Growing fruit that's dried by end of evening (7) : RAISING
12
Trainees amid seabirds (7) : INTERNS
13
Reportedly save a crowd (5) : HORDE
15
Head cook swallows iodine (5) : CHIEF
16
Jennings holds head runner's measuring device (9) : PEDOMETER
18
Doesn't work in one's skivvies? (6,3) : SLACKSOFF
21
Thoroughly clean low bushes (5) : SCRUB
23
Polish translation (5) : GLOSS
25
Broadcasting medium savaged diorama (2,5) : AMRADIO
27
Mother left with fat duck (7) : MALLARD
28
Little brat leading dear African antelopes (7) : IMPALAS
29
Noisy swamp creature keeps beneath the surface (10) : THUNDERING
30
Snakes like empty promises (4) : ASPS
Down
1
Six cheer about Peruvian's box of string? (6,4) : VIOLINCASE
2
Orchestra conductors tire Sam out (7) : MAESTRI
4
Is capable of arranging fuel stop around end of voyage (5,2,2) : FEELSUPTO
5
Senator Chiles offers a light (5) : TORCH
6
Saying English slob is on strike (7) : EPIGRAM
7
Kitchen invader eats green food (7) : ALIMENT
8
Corporate symbol goalie found in bathroom (4) : LOGO
10
Line cans up (5) : SERIF
14
Really hates riding war steeds (4,6) : ARABHORSES
17
Pitching tail end of economic downturn (9) : DEFLATION
19
Poet Maya cut out after God's messenger (7) : ANGELOU
20
"Knockout" operator put down a mixed drink? (4-3) : KOOLAID
21
Rag fight (5) : SCRAP
22
Pierces puzzles (7) : RIDDLES
24
Prophet holds down meal at Passover (5) : SEDER
26
Send Warner's partner up (4) : EMIT
